High Strength, High Conductivity in the Global Copper-beryllium Alloys Market:
High strength and high conductivity are two key attributes of copper-beryllium alloys that make them highly desirable in the global market. These alloys are known for their exceptional strength, which is comparable to that of steel, and their superior electrical and thermal conductivity, which is second only to silver among metals. This unique combination of properties makes copper-beryllium alloys ideal for a wide range of applications, from telecommunications and automotive to computers and aerospace. The alloys' high strength allows them to withstand extreme conditions and heavy loads, while their high conductivity ensures efficient energy transfer. This makes them particularly useful in applications that require both durability and energy efficiency, such as electrical connectors, switches, and relays.
Telecommunication Equipment, Automotive, Computer, Aircraft & Aerospace, Other in the Global Copper-beryllium Alloys Market:
The Global Copper-beryllium Alloys Market finds extensive usage in various sectors such as Telecommunication Equipment, Automotive, Computer, Aircraft & Aerospace, among others. In the telecommunication sector, these alloys are used in connectors, switches, and relays due to their high conductivity and strength. In the automotive industry, they are used in various components such as connectors, sensors, and switches due to their ability to withstand high temperatures and resist corrosion. In the computer industry, copper-beryllium alloys are used in connectors and heat sinks due to their excellent thermal conductivity. In the aircraft and aerospace industry, these alloys are used in various components due to their high strength-to-weight ratio and resistance to corrosion.
Global Copper-beryllium Alloys Market Outlook:
The future of the Global Copper-beryllium Alloys Market looks promising, with a steady growth trajectory projected for the coming years. In 2022, the market was valued at US$ 1377 million. This figure is expected to rise to US$ 1748.7 million by 2029, representing a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 3.4% during the forecast period from 2023 to 2029. This growth is expected to be driven by increasing demand from various end-use industries, technological advancements, and the unique properties of copper-beryllium alloys that make them ideal for a wide range of applications.
